Özet
Objectives Onychomycosis is the general term to define fungal nail infections that arise from dermatophytes, non-dermatophytic moulds and yeasts. Thiol/disulphide homeostasis is a new indicator of oxidative stress. In this study, we aimed to investigate the role of thiol/disulphide balance in the pathogenesis of onychomycosis.
